Research Software Engineer im Bereich Mobile Sensor Systems (all genders) (Wissenschaftliche/r Mitarbeiter/in)

Fraunhofer-Gesellschaft e.V. Zentrale München – Karlsruhe

Kurzbeschreibung der Position

Als Research Software Engineer (all genders) arbeiten Sie an der Schnittstelle zwischen wissenschaftlicher Forschung und professioneller Softwareentwicklung. Sie konzipieren, entwickeln und evaluieren Forschungssoftware für die bildbasierte Lokalisierung mobiler Sensorplattformen.

Hauptaufgaben

  • Der Schwerpunkt der Verfahren liegt im Bereich der Computer Vision und des Machine Learnings - insbesondere bei der Lokalisierung mittels Referenzdaten und Onboard-Bildsensorik.
  • Besonders relevant sind lernbasierte Verfahren unter Nutzung moderner Frameworks (z. B. PyTorch, JAX oder TensorFlow), bildbasierte 3D-Rekonstruktionsverfahren sowie moderne Renderingbibliotheken.
  • Entwicklung und Betrieb von Softwarekomponenten in containerisierten Umgebungen (z. B. Docker) für reproduzierbare Experimente sowie zur einfachen Übertragbarkeit auf unterschiedliche Zielplattformen.
  • Integration der entwickelten Verfahren in reale Sensorplattformen und Demonstratoren. Deployment und Optimierung von Algorithmen auf Edge-Plattformen (z. B. NVIDIA Jetson) und Echtzeit-Controllern (z. B. Pixhawk-Hardware und PX4-Autopilot).
  • Sicherstellung von Codequalität, Reproduzierbarkeit und nachhaltiger Nutzbarkeit.
  • Zusammenarbeit mit anderen wissenschaftlichen Mitarbeite*innen und externen Projektpartnern.
  • Mitwirkung an der Integration in Gesamtsysteme.
  • Durchführung von Demonstrationen und Feldversuchen
  • Erstellung von Projektberichten

Qualifikationen und Fähigkeiten

  • Ein abgeschlossenes Hochschulstudium (Master) der Informatik oder einer vergleichbaren Fachrichtung.
  • Sehr gute Programmierkenntnisse, insbesondere Python und/oder C++.
  • Grundlegende Kenntnisse oder praktische Erfahrungen in Bildverarbeitung oder Computer Vision (zum Beispiel in bildbasierten Verfahren zur Lokalisierung, Registrierung oder 3D-Rekonstruktion).
  • Idealerweise Kenntnisse oder Erfahrungen im Bereich Containerisierung (z. B. Docker), in Robotik-Frameworks (z. B. ROS), Edge-Plattformen (z. B. NVIDIA Jetson) sowie Autopiloten und Echtzeit-Controller (z. B. Pixhawk-Hardware, PX4-Autopilot).
  • Sehr gute Deutsch- und gute Englischkenntnisse.

Arbeitsort / Rahmenbedingungen

  • Eine abwechslungsreiche Tätigkeit an der Schnittstelle zwischen Wissenschaft und Praxis - mit direktem Bezug zu Zukunftstechnologien und gesellschaftlich relevanten Anwendungen.
  • Freiraum zur Entfaltung und die Möglichkeit, eigene Ideen und Projekte aktiv einzubringen.
  • Exzellente technische Ausstattung und optimale Arbeitsbedingungen.
  • Motivierte Kolleg*innen, die sich durch ihre interdisziplinäre und internationale Zusammensetzung gegenseitig inspirieren.
  • Attraktive Rahmenbedingungen zur Vereinbarkeit von Beruf und Privatleben (z. B. flexible Arbeitszeiten innerhalb eines Gleitzeitmodells, individuelle Home-Office-Regelungen).
  • Individuelle Karrierepfade durch Fortbildungs- und Entwicklungsmöglichkeiten (z. B. Förder- und Entwicklungsprogramm »Fraunhofer TALENTA« für Wissenschaftlerinnen und weibliche Führungskräfte).
  • Kostenfreie Parkplätze und eine leistungsfähige Ladeinfrastruktur für Elektrofahrzeuge.
  • Eine Kantine sowie nahegelegene Einkaufsmöglichkeiten.
  • Eine sehr gute Anbindung an den ÖPNV sowie ein Zuschuss zum Deutschlandticket.